Emit DW_AT_GNU_bias with -fgnat-encodings=gdb. gdb implements this,
but not the encoded variant.
Tested on x86_64-pc-linux-gnu, committed on trunk
2019-09-19 Tom Tromey <tro...@adacore.com>
gcc/ada/
* gcc-interface/misc.c (gnat_get_type_bias): Return the bias
when -fgnat-encodings=gdb.
gcc/testsuite/
* gnat.dg/bias1.adb: New testcase.
--- gcc/ada/gcc-interface/misc.c
+++ gcc/ada/gcc-interface/misc.c
@@ -1111,7 +1111,7 @@ gnat_get_type_bias (const_tree gnu_type)
{
if (TREE_CODE (gnu_type) == INTEGER_TYPE
&& TYPE_BIASED_REPRESENTATION_P (gnu_type)
- && gnat_encodings == DWARF_GNAT_ENCODINGS_MINIMAL)
+ && gnat_encodings != DWARF_GNAT_ENCODINGS_ALL)
return TYPE_RM_MIN_VALUE (gnu_type);
return NULL_TREE;
